Protractor in geometry

A Protractor is a tool found in a geometry box usually made of plastic and used to measure angles. The protractor is also used to draw angles of given measures in degrees. There are different types of protractors that serve different purposes, such as a circular protractor which can measure angles up to 360o. Then, there is Bevel protractor which is a circular protractor attached to an arm so that the protractor can move about the joint, it is mainly used for architectural designing.

What is a Protractor?

A protractor in geometry is generally in the shape of a semi-circle which is divided into 180 equal parts and each part measures one degree. Hence, the ordinary protractor in a geometry box measures angles up to 180o. Protractors that we find in our geometry box are generally made of plastic but they are also made of wood, steel and in some cases glass. Most protractors measure the angle in degrees but there are few protractors available that can measure angles in radian, they are known as Radian-scale protractors.

How to Use a Protractor to Measure an Angle

Let us see step by step how to measure an angle using a protractor,

Step 1: Suppose an angle given ∠AOB, whose measure we need to find out. Place the zero of the protractor accurately on the vertex of the given angle and the base arm of the angle coinciding with the zero degrees line of the protractor.

Step 2: After placing the protractor accurately, we read the measure of the angle, since we are measuring in anticlockwise, we will read the inner calibration.

Step 3: Now, observe carefully and note down marking. So, the measure of ∠AOB = 60o

How to Use a Protractor to Draw an Angle

Let us see step by step how to draw an angle using a protractor,

Step 1: Draw a line segment AB using a ruler.

Step 2: Now place the protractor on one of the ends of the line segment AB such that the end of line segment coincides with zero of the protractor and the base of the protractor coincide with the line segment. Mark the point of whichever degree angle you want to make.

Step 3: Now remove the protractor and join the marked point to point A of the line segment with the help of a ruler and pencil.

And we have ∠CAB = 55o drawn with the help of a protractor.

Some Important Points Related to Protractors

  • The angle we measure with the ordinary protractor in a geometry box is in degrees (o).
  • Whenever we are measuring angle in the anticlockwise direction we read the inner calibration of the protractor while measuring the angle in a clockwise direction we read the outer calibration of the protractor.

  • The inner and outer calibration of the protractor is the measure of supplementary angles, that is, they add up to 180o.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s on Protractor)

Q1

What is a protractor in geometry?

A protractor is a tool that is used to measure and draw angles in geometry. A protractor in a geometry box is in the shape of half-disc or semicircular which can measure up to 180
degrees.

Q2

What is the main use of a protractor?

A protractor is used for measuring and drawing angles.

Q3

Is it necessary to have a protractor for geometry?

A protractor is used to measure and draw angles but alternatively, we can draw certain
angles with the help of compasses and measure them by applying certain geometrical properties.

Q4

How do we measure angles using a protractor?

Put the zero of the protractor coinciding with the vertex of the angle, also make sure that the
base arm of the angle is in line with the baseline or zero degrees line of the protractor. Now note the measure of the angle carefully.

Q5

What are the two uses of a protractor?

Protractors are used by architects to measure angles while designing any structure. Military protractors are used to determine the accurate direction by measuring the angle.
